Placement Experience

4

Many companies visited our college, i can't remember all but some of them were, excel fertilisers, amul, mother dairy, parle, itc, and many other local companies.The recruitment process was, that first you have to make a list of companies you're interested in then apply for their on campus placement form then you'll be needed to show them your grades followed by an interview. The tentative percentage of the students who got placed out of how many applied for the on campus placement, was somewhere near 70-75%.yes, the college management arranged us special classes for our personality building, and interview skills, which turned out to be very useful for most of the students.

Fee Structure And Facilities

My fees was 3500 rupees per semester, making it a total of around 21000 rupees for my whole 3 year course, which is not expensive and cheaper than every other college in the city. there were no big additional charges for anything and there was no fees at all for securing admission in my course. The college provided the vet good transparency, we were handed over a receipt for every penny we ever paid of.

Fees and Financial Aid

i personally wasn't not on any scholarship, but the scholarships were there for the deserved students. the procedure for applying scholarships was to apply for the scholarship in the beginning of course, you just have to show your previous information and financial information and once the documents are verified, you're eligible for scholarship. scholarships breaking criteria was different based on student's financial conditions and educational achievements. There was upto 70%scholarships.

Admission

I opt for bsc. because I've always wanted to pursue a career in science. one of the many reasons of why i chose this college was it was in my home city, and apart from that it's the best college in city in studies, in sports, in cultural activities and many more. To get admission in government college hisar, firstly you have to complete your 12th, then apply for the course you want to get admitted in, submit your documents, then you have to wait for the merit list, if you have your name in the list then get your documents verified and that's it.
